'Lady Bridget in the Never-Never Land' Summary
Lady Bridget O'Hara, an Englishwoman scorned in love, accepts an invitation to travel to colonial Australia as a companion to the wife of the newly-appointed governor. In the rugged outback, she meets Colin McKeith, a Scottish pioneer who captures her heart. Despite their contrasting backgrounds, they marry and embark on a life together, facing the challenges of the unforgiving landscape, labor shortages, and the plight of Indigenous Australians. Their relationship is further strained when Bridget's former lover, Willoughby Maule, visits, reopening old wounds and testing their bond. Through their journey, the novel explores themes of love, adventure, cultural differences, and the complexities of colonial Australia.Book Details
